No corona vaccination required: Djokovic in Wimbledon

Novak Djokovic and unvaccinated players to be allowed to compete at Wimbledon this summer This is not a prerequisite for participation in the third Grand Slam tournament of the year from June 27 to July 10, said Sally Bolton, Managing Director of All England Lawn Tennis Club (Aeltc), on Tuesday. Djokovic has won the title six times in Wimbledon so far, most recently he was successful last year.

Bolton emphasized that they would encourage professionals to vaccination. The British government would also no longer prescribe this for an entry. "We are planning to return to a normal tournament this year," said Bolton. "That is why we will not implement any of the COVID 19 measures of the past year in substantial form."

The 34 -year -old Djokovic was unable to defend his title at the Australian Open at the beginning of the season because he was expelled because of the lack of vaccination of the country. For this reason, too, he was not allowed at the US tournaments in Indian Wells and Miami. Djokovic had last lost in the final at his home tournament in Belgrade. There are also no Corona rules in the way of starting in Rome and the French Open.
